We are an educational camp for boys and girls between the ages of 6 and 22 years old who experience difficulty when it comes to learning, communication, and socialization. Our camp programs, activities, and games are designed for children who have been diagnosed with Asperger’s, ADHD, or Autism and want to overcome barriers in life they may experience and focus on meeting new friends, building friendships, exploring nature, and enjoying summer.
